Output 77fa39b1bd148869c6925a0905a84c6157c37d6466251fc58bad7ffea2e4195e:6

value
49568650
script pubkey
OP_HASH160 OP_PUSHBYTES_20 29ad95b145737d64e66d3c42a111c491dc78da9c OP_EQUAL
address
MBhXtB45vK5EUD9p3x3gegqARvuLFN9M9U
transaction
77fa39b1bd148869c6925a0905a84c6157c37d6466251fc58bad7ffea2e4195e
spent
true